Centre for Contemporary Arts (CCA)
350 Sauchiehall St
82 personas locales recomiendan
Great cafe/bar/restaurant. Does vegan food but it has widespread appeal. The main bar is especially nice place to go for lunch. Family friendly. Beer garden upstairs (one of very few decent ones in the city centre!) They also have regular exhibitions and two cool little shops: one for books, one for art & design. Great place to pick up some souvenirs for friends. Secret tip: Every second Sunday the upstairs bar CCA hosts a board game club. You pay £2 and get access to any of the host Kenny's vast collection. A great way to spend an afternoon.

Mother India's Cafe
1355 Argyle St
118 personas locales recomiendan
A Glasgow institution. A good choice if you've just left Kelvingrove. They have three restaurants pretty much side by side: Mother India's Cafe: Tapas-style, probably the best one. Mother India: Main restaurant, a bit more traditional. Dining In: Small restaurant section, but does a great take-away deal where you buy the meal from their fridge section and heat up at home. It's pretty good value for money and better than your standard take-away.

Inn Deep
445 Great Western Rd
54 personas locales recomiendan
Pub owned by Scottish the scottish craft-brewers Williams. Great selection of reasonably priced beers and ever-changing guest kegs to boot. The beer garden is right by the river Kelvin and actually situated on the kelvin walkway. Particularly well known around these parts for its dog-friendly policy - expect to be surrounded by canines.

Glasgow Botanic Gardens
730 Great Western Rd
432 personas locales recomiendan
A good sized park with lots to see and do. The two glass houses (the famous Kibble Palace is one) have a great selection - recommended to anyone. Secret spot: In some areas, you can peak down and see where the old Botanics Train Station used to be. It's overgrown and covered in grafitti now.
